DCRE police personnel in Karnataka to receive hardship allowance

The Karnataka government has decided to provide a monthly hardship allowance to 626 police personnel serving in 33 police stations under the Directorate of Civil Rights Enforcement (DCRE). This decision comes after recommendations by Mohan Kumar Danappa, Member of the Karnataka State Police Complaints Authority (SPCA), who noted the challenging nature of DCRE police personnel's duties in investigating atrocities against Scheduled Castes (SCs) and Scheduled Tribes (STs).

The allowance, which includes ₹2,000 for Police Sub-Inspectors (PSIs), ₹2,000 for Police Head Constables (HCs), and ₹3,000 for Police Constables (PCs), will help alleviate the heavy workload and inadequate benefits these personnel currently face.
